Transaction d831ea5b936ebdf00b6139f7a722247e839d6fba10e498fa14f225388a31ac30
1 Input
1 Output
-
d831ea5b936ebdf00b6139f7a722247e839d6fba10e498fa14f225388a31ac30:0
- value
- 1977289
- script pubkey
- OP_0 OP_PUSHBYTES_20 68a8c24887b483c0e58dc6763f74fc870cac9932
- address
- bc1qdz5vyjy8kjpupevdcemr7a8usux2exfjgueqn4